Frequently Asked Questions about Clifton Community

What type of rentals are currently available in Clifton Community?

There are currently 267 Apartments for Rent in Clifton Community, GA with pricing that ranges from $825 to $15,950. There are also 103 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Clifton Community ranging from $965 to $17,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Clifton Community?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Clifton Community ranges from $965 to $17,000 with an average monthly rent of $7,071.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Clifton Community?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Clifton Community range from $830 to $6,043,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,899 to $6,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,975 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,495.
